Javcaribbean.com

More Videos

Battle of the Sexes 1440p

Battle of the Sexes

31,412 370
Defloration means 4K

Defloration means

46,509 141
Cathy Heaven vs. Imi 1440p

Cathy Heaven vs. Imi

2,481 425